ORGANOLEPTIC PROFILE
COLOUR: lightly rosè coloured wine.
BOUQUET: fruit and aromatic herbs.
FLAVOUR: fresh, persistent, harmonious taste.
RECOMMENDED: as an aperitif, and as such, can be mixed with fruit juices. Excellent with cold starters, salmon and dry biscuits.
ALCOHOL: 11,5% vol.
BOTTLE: 0,75 lt.
BOTTLES PRODUCED: 2.000
WINEMAKING PROCESS
TYPE OF WINE: Vino Spumante Brut Rosato.
GRAPES: selection of Barbera e Pinot Nero, in rosè.
PLACE OF PRODUCTION: Zola Predosa – Bologna.
PROCESS: manual vintage, lightly macerated in the skins for a short period, and is then allowed to ferment very slowly in stainless steel tanks at controlled temperature (15°C).
MALOLACTIC FERMENTATION: no.
AGEING PERIOD: re-fermentation at length at controlled temperature in autoclave and then aged on the lees (over 1 month).
